CM1 background wind profile generator and visualizer (GrADS)
A script that produces up to 20 custom background momentum profiles for nudging in Cloud Model 1 (CM1). Current capabilities are limited, with key options including vertical shear-layer and steering-layer specification. Background shear is confined to a specified layer, and uniform profiles of u and v exist outside the shear layer. The change of u and/or v with height within the shear layer is sinusoidal, and any added momentum within the steering layer by the shear specification is offset by a secondary waveform (i.e., the shear does not directly add a steering-layer mean component). Uses default thermodynamic and mass profiles. See notes in this document.
Peer-reviewed Publications
Ahern, K., R. E. Hart, and M. A. Bourassa (2022): Asymmetric hurricane boundary layer structure during storm decay. Part II: Secondary eyewall formation. Mon. Wea. Rev., 150 (8), 1915–1936, doi:10.1175/MWR-D-21-0247.1
Ahern, K., R. E. Hart, and M. A. Bourassa (2021): Asymmetric hurricane boundary layer structure during storm decay. Part I: Formation of descending inflow. Mon. Wea. Rev., 149 (11), 3851–3874, doi:10.1175/MWR-D-21-0030.1.
Ahern, K., M. A. Bourassa, R. E. Hart, J. A. Zhang, and R. F. Rogers (2019): Observed kinematic and thermodynamic structure in the hurricane boundary layer during intensity change. Mon. Wea. Rev., 147 (8), 2765–2785, doi:10.1175/MWR-D-18-0380.1.
Ahern, K. and L. Cowan (2018): Minimizing errors when projecting geospatial data onto a vortex-centered space. Geophys. Res. Lett., 45, doi:10.1029/2018GL079953.
